standard by International Organization for Standardization, 07/01/1998
This part of ISO 9022 specifies methods for the testing of optical instruments and instruments containing optical components, under equivalent conditions, for their ability to resist combined shock, bump or free fall, in dry heat or cold.
The purpose of the testing is to investigate to what extent the optical, thermal, mechanical, chemical and electrical performance characteristics of the specimen are affected by combined shock, bump or free fall, in dry heat or cold.
